Noncommutative cyclic isolated singularities
Abstract
The question of whether a noncommutative graded quotient singularity AG is isolated depends on a subtle invariant of the G-action on A, called the pertinency. We prove a partial dichotomy theorem for isolatedness, which applies to a family of noncommutative quotient singularities arising from a graded cyclic action on the (-1)-skew polynomial ring. Our results generalize and extend some results of Bao, He and the third-named author and results of Gaddis, Kirkman, Moore and Won.
